Follow up to selective packer
Additional options added to selective packer should be per line as mentioned as TODO.
struct Options {
// TODO: make these 'per container' instead of global
bool add_track_ancestors = false;
bool add_calo_digits = false;
bool add_calo_clusters = false;
bool add_tagger_particles = false;
bool add_pv_tracks = false;
bool prune_relations = true;
};
They are already per line in configuration, but get merged in the code:
ShoppingList::Options{.add_track_ancestors = any_fired( m_addTrackAncestors ),
.add_calo_digits = any_fired( m_addCaloDigits ),
.add_calo_clusters = any_fired( m_addCaloClusters ),
.add_tagger_particles = any_fired( m_addTagParticles ),
.add_pv_tracks = any_fired( m_addPVTracks )},